#694f51 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#694f51 is composed of 41.2% red, 31% green and 31.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 24.8% magenta, 22.9% yellow and 58.8% black. It has a hue angle of 355.4 degrees, a saturation of 14.1% and a lightness of 36.1%. #694f51 color hex could be obtained by blending #d29ea2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

● #694f51 color description : Very dark grayish red.
#694f51 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#694f51 has RGB values of R:105, G:79, B:81 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.25, Y:0.23, K:0.59. Its decimal value is 6901585.
